ISLAMABAD: A court has sent two suspects arrested in the Hina Javed murder case to Adiala Jail on 14-day judicial remand.
The suspects, identified as the victim’s husband Faisal Asghar and his employee Zeeshan, were produced before Duty Civil Judge Adil Sarwar Sial.
During the hearing, the investigating officer informed the court that the police investigation was continuing but physical custody of the suspects was no longer required.
The court subsequently sent both suspects to jail on 14-day judicial remand and ordered police to produce them again on September 16.
Police were also directed to complete the investigation and submit the challan before the court by September 16.
According to police, investigators allegedly recovered a suspected murder weapon, screwdriver, cloth and iron wire from the suspects during the investigation.
Police said marriage certificates relating to Faisal Asghar’s first and second marriages were also recovered from him, along with the divorce certificate of his first wife, identified as Iram Zaib.
Investigators said the marriage and divorce documents had been verified by the relevant union council.
Both suspects had previously remained in police custody on 10-day physical remand. Following the latest court order, police shifted them to Adiala Jail.
The allegations against the suspects remain subject to trial and have yet to be determined by a court.
